Loose is an online radio station for the eclectic, the experimental and the ecstatic. Born from the challenges of the pandemic and our love of music, Movement Digital decided to start its own online radio station. Having discussed the idea for many years, the overshadow of the pandemic inspired us to hit the button and create a station that celebrated all genres of music with a joyful, groovy and festival-like embrace.
Launched and based in the offices of Movement Digital, Loose.fm because a fresh new brand that we could grow and develop from the ground up.
Initiated by our Creative Director & Radio Controller Mark Freeman, I took it upon myself to become the Loose.fm lead designer and brand guardian - I defined, created and continuously developed the Loose.fm site and all its social content, while also refining and evolving the brand aesthetic as it increased in popularity and reach.
The “LOOSE” letters became the backbone from which all the creative was hung and the Loose.fm site was the hub from which our listeners could hear their favourite DJ’s.

Daily Content - DJ & Show Line-up
With Loose.fm playing shows nearly 24/7, a constant stream of social posts were required to share and promote each DJ/Show - In addition, a daily show line-up was produced.
Speed and consistency were the key to outpouring so much content. To deliver this I designed a flexible template to house the DJ show images and names, incorporating the Loose.fm branding and colour ways, which could be quickly interchanged and outputted. In addition, I also defined a separate video template that was used for the daily show line-up. The intention being that no post felt the exact same – but still followed the strict brand rules I established.



Loose X Choose Love
For a one-day exclusive Loose.fm partnered up with Choose Love – Hosting at the Choose Love pop-up store on Carnaby St, Loose.fm DJs were invited to spin tunes in support of this most vital organisation. Choose Love does whatever it takes to provide refugees and displaced people with everything from lifesaving search and rescue boats to food and legal advice.
For this I designed a bespoke DJ post template and other supporting assets, to promote the event, the DJ’s playing and the "Loose X Choose Love" partnership.



Turkey-Syria Fundraiser

In response to the horrendous earthquake in Turkey/Syria, which took the life of more than 50,000 people and affected millions of people on the 6th of February, Makkam in partnership with Loose.fm put on a day long fundraiser on the 27th February.
The Loose.fm site was re-dressed out of respect and a link for donations was added. Loose.fm branded DJ posts were dropped and a single day long post was created instead.

Results & Key Achievements
-
After only 3 months, Loose.fm had reached 2500 unique listeners a month since launching in late September 2021 - this continued to increase exponentially with Loose.fm’s reach and following consistently growing over time.
​
-
Loose.fm successful catalogued a vast range of eclectic and talented DJ’s, both playing live and pre-recorded shows allowing Loose to stream 24/7.
​
-
Loose.fm played host to several exclusive parties and events around London, as well as being involved in several charitable partnerships.
